WHAT YOU’LL NEED
1 cup raw cashews (soaked for 4 to 8 hours)
1/3 cup cocoa powder
1 tsp. vanilla extract
1 tsp. cinnamon
2 tbs. agave nectar
1/2 tsp. sea salt
3 cups water

HOW TO MAKE IT…
Drain the cashews and rinse with cold water. Combine cashews and remaining ingredients in a blender (we used a Vitamix, but any high-speed model should do the trick). Start at a low speed, then crank up to high. Let the mixture blend for about five minutes, or until it reaches the desired toasty temperature and creamy consistency. Serve immediately in a mug or tumbler.

Makes three servings.
